scrobble

verb - transitive

  • of software, to extract details from a user's music collection, possibly sending those details to an Internet-based service. User actions such as the specific songs played in a music player may also be sent.

space out

verb - intransitive

  • to lose one's concentration.
    Stop spacing out and work on your homework.

    Last edited on Sep 03 2010. Submitted by Walter Rader (Editor) from Sacramento, CA, USA on Sep 14 2009.

  • to forget to do something.
    I was supposed to pick him up at the airport but I spaced out.
